Inspiration
Students often struggle with long notes, difficult concepts, and lack of time before exams. We wanted to create an AI-powered platform that makes studying faster, easier, and smarter.
What it does
StudyMate AI helps students by:
- 📝 Summarizing notes and PDFs
- 🎯 Generating quizzes automatically
- 💡 Explaining difficult topics simply
How we built it
We built the project using HTML, CSS, and JavaScript.
For AI features, we integrated the Google Gemini API.
We also used PDF.js for reading PDFs and jsPDF for downloading summaries.
Challenges we ran into
- Integrating the Gemini API
- Extracting text from PDFs
- Managing long AI responses
- Creating a responsive UI design
Accomplishments that we're proud of
- Successfully integrated AI into an educational platform
- Built a clean and modern UI
- Added multiple AI-powered study tools in one website
- Completed the project during the hackathon
What we learned
We learned:
- AI API integration
- Async JavaScript
- PDF handling in web apps
- UI/UX improvement
- Team collaboration and debugging
What's next for StudyMate AI
- Voice assistant support
- Flashcard generation
- AI study planner
- More language support
- User login and cloud storage
Log in or sign up for Devpost to join the conversation.